DuPage Pads is seeking an Employment Specialist to join their team. This position is responsible for preparing program participants to seek, obtain, and retain employment. This position is also responsible for networking with area businesses and industries to identify appropriate job opportunities, job development and placement strategies for individuals who are homeless; facilitating curricula to provide ongoing support services; and serving as a liaison between the program and the job site.   • Operates within the DuPagePads Core Values, which supports providing care in accordance with the Trauma Informed Policy and Practices of the Agency.
  • Assist with the screening, application, and assessment process for prospective workforce participants; ensuring the participants are fully committed to invest the time and apply the proper priority to program participation.
  • Establish career goals in collaboration with participants and their respective case manager.
  • Provide and facilitate employment workshops and training for job readiness and job retention.
  • Provide accessibility and linkages to community-based education and training programs courses
  • Network with area business and associations to identify and advocate for appropriate job opportunities for program participants.
  • Develop partnerships with businesses, industries, government and employment agencies to secure appropriate employment opportunities.
  • Cultivate strong relationships with employers and program participants, identifying specific needs and skills required by specific employers and matching to proven talents, abilities, goals and experience of program participants.
  • Motivate and provide on-going support to program participants to help manage and retain employment.
  • Develop, maintain, and provide knowledge on current tax and work incentives for both employers and program participants.
  • Advocate for increased community education, relationships, and solutions to benefit our client population.
  • Prepare and maintain accurate files and reports.
  • Assist in interviewing, training and managing volunteers.
  • Develop, update and maintain an Employment Resource area.
  • Participate in weekly supervision meetings and monthly staff meetings.
  • Must occasionally drive participants to employment opportunities.
